Key dates
4 October 1847 (1847-10-04)Opened as Stockton
April 1867renamed Stockton Forest
c.1870renamed Stockton-on-Forest
1 February 1872renamed Warthill
5 January 1959 (1959-01-05)closed

Warthill railway station was a station on the York to Beverley Line. It opened as Stockton station in 1847–8, was renamed to Stockton Forest (later Stockton-on-the-Forest) in 1867; in 1872 it became Warthill station. The station closed in 1959.
